If I were going to buy a new home, I would read this book very carefully because it's filled full of information that you need to know to be prepared. For one thing, you really can't trust anyone but yourself to look out for your best interest. She gives great examples of how people have been ripped off and they thought they were getting a bargain. For instance, the "no down" when buying a house may be no down payment then, but you will pay for it later and in another way. There are lots of costs added on that you can avoid if you read this ahead of time and go prepared. She recommends always having your own real estate agent and mortgage broker (check them out to make sure they are honest though!). After reading about all the trouble you can get into on your own, I am in agreement with her. She also explains how you can get your credit rating up, how foreclosing on a house can hurt it bad and how you can get it back to normal.Since banks are no longer loaning credit for houses except to people with excellent credit rating, then it makes sense to have yours in great shape before you even try to buy. She tells of all the fees involved (some aren't even needed but you'll have to read the book to find out which ones they are) and how you can get them lowered and save thousands of dollars. And there are a lot of scams going on for home buyers that you need to be aware of. As a small businessman and even smaller real estate investor,a licensed R.E.Broker and General Contractor,I wholeheartedly recommend Homebuyers Beware to all home buyers,first timers and seasoned investors alike. I read Carolyn Warren's first book,Mortgage Rip-Offs,a few months ago and liked it so much I contacted her for consultation re:refinancing of my properties.Eventhough I bought my first home over 30 years ago and many since,I must confess I know NOTHING about yield spread premium and the way brokers/lenders use YSP to add income to themself before reading that book.The YSP information alone was worth thousand times the cost of the book(approx.$13 from AMAZON.COM)because I know absolutely, definitely that the brokers' additional income must come only from one source : borrowers like you and me. There were other important information for ALL mortgage seekers in the first book :how to negotiate for lower fees and rates,whether to pay point,how and what to do with junk fees etc.All those and more were explained and clarified further in Carolyn's second book,Homebuyers Beware. In her new book,Carolyn takes her readers to the real estate mortgage market situation today.This is most important due to the fact that rules for qualifying for new and refi mortgages changed substantially in the last 2 years it's like we're looking at 2 different creatures altogather : ---no more easy no loan docs. loan,no more easy qualifying loans ---good credit is a must.So are substantial down payment required in most cases ---W-2,income tax returns and bank staments are all standard required docs. ---etc.,etc Carolyn explained all of the above in practical details,with intended benefit for the consumers.Even for readers who've no credit,with bankruptcy/shortsale in their credit report or who want to repudiate bad info. in his/her credit files.The book is,like her first book,very easy to read and full of helpfull pointers that can be used to save unnecessary fees/chrges made by lenders/brokers. I was not a major real estate investor, just an average homeowner, but I had a "friend" who was a mortgage broker for Countrywide.He kept pushing me into (what I know now were) increasingly worse loans.At the top of the market he came to me with an income property that was such a great deal that if I didn't jump on it he was going to buy it himself (and I believed that?What a sucker!) I didn't listen to my inner voice which kept telling me that none of this added up.Instead I deferred to him because I thought he was an "expert" who knew so much more than me (turns out he didn't even have a high school diploma and had only been selling mortgages for 6 months when I met him... before that he sold used cars!)I also thought that he had my best interest at heart, when, in fact, the only thing he cared about was his commissions. I'm currently in a short-sale on that investment property: it's in escrow for 1/3(!!) of what I paid for it and we were lucky to get that. My home was foreclosed on a year ago.Thirty years of excellent credit is destroyed.I'm not blaming the mortgage broker, I could have rejected any of his offers.I was just under-educated about how real estate mortgages REALLY work, but not anymore. As I read this book, it was like reading a postmortem of my financial situation.I cannot tell you how many times while reading it I shouted, "That Bastard!That's exactly what he did to me!"As I dissected my mistakes and the ways in which I was conned, and learned how to avoid similar traps in the future, I began to feel as though I might actually have some hope of fixing this mess and restoring my good credit and, perhaps, even owning property again someday. But even if I don't ever buy another piece of real estate, I'm glad I read this book because now at least I understand what happened to me (and to so many otherwise well-educated, successful people,) and I don't feel like such a complete failure anymore.In that regard, this book is better (and way cheaper,) than therapy.
